Types of Cleated Conveyor Belts

At Karl Schmidt Mfg Inc., we recognize the importance of versatility in recycling operations. Cleated conveyor belts are pivotal in achieving this, coming in various types such as T-profiles, mini cleats, and multi-chevron patterns. Each design serves specific materials and incline requirements, ensuring efficient material handling in recycling facilities.

Comparison of Cleated Conveyor Belts with Other Types of Conveyor Belts

  • Efficiency on Inclines: Unlike flat belts, cleated belts can handle steeper inclines, making them ideal for various recycling processes.
  • Material Handling: They are superior in controlling material spillage and ensuring precise material placement.
  • Versatility: Cleated belts can be customized to a wider range of applications compared to standard conveyor belts.
